Transaction 8c87ddeac3a669e1dc15194f51ea6889701c3f739ddd052928b2b361697c0a82

1 Input
2 Outputs
  • 8c87ddeac3a669e1dc15194f51ea6889701c3f739ddd052928b2b361697c0a82:0
  • value  9523109
    address  3HSDd3gY7kBKe2gvCu1BtTaZAAdDhtv93m
  • 8c87ddeac3a669e1dc15194f51ea6889701c3f739ddd052928b2b361697c0a82:1
  • value  576981419
    address  3A9WNYHVtpL3x7T2k6PWSBexbUxLvRnAC7